### **ARTICLE III**
### **CLASSIFICATION AND TREATMENT OF CLAIMS**
#### <span id="page-15-3"></span><span id="page-15-2"></span>A. *Summary*
1. In accordance with Section 1123(a)(1) of the Bankruptcy Code, the Debtor has not classified Administrative Claims, Professional Compensation Claims, United States Trustee fees and Priority Tax Claims, as described in Article II. Accordingly, except for such Claims, all Claims are placed in Classes as set forth below.
2. The following table classifies Claims against the Debtor for all purposes, including voting, confirmation and Distribution pursuant hereto and pursuant to Sections 1122 and 1123(a)(1) of the Bankruptcy Code. The Plan deems a Claim to be classified in a particular Class only to the extent that the Claim qualifies within the description of that Class and shall be deemed classified in a different Class to the extent that any remainder of such Claim qualifies within the description of such different Class. A Claim is in a particular Class only to the extent that any such Claim is Allowed in that Class and has not been paid or otherwise settled prior to the Effective Date.
#### Case 22-50073 Doc 197 Filed 04/10/22 Entered 04/10/22 21:11:27 Page 17 of 41 Case 22-50073 Doc 249-7 Filed 04/22/22 Entered 04/22/22 16:44:32 Page 17 of 41
| Class | Claim | Status | Voting Rights | |-------|-----------------------------|------------|----------------------------------------| | 1 | Other Secured Claims | Unimpaired | Not Entitled to Vote; Deemed to Accept | | 2 | Priority Non-Tax Claims | Unimpaired | Not Entitled to Vote; Deemed to Accept | | 3 | Unsecured Litigation Claims | Impaired | Entitled to Vote | | 4 | Unsecured Trade Claims | Impaired | Entitled to Vote | | 5 | Litigation Funding Claims | Impaired | Entitled to Vote |
### <span id="page-16-0"></span>B. *Classification and Treatment of Claims*
1. Other Secured Claims (Class 1)
(a) *Classification*: Class 1 consists of Other Secured Claims.
(b) *Treatment*: Unless otherwise mutually agreed upon by the holder of an Allowed Other Secured Claim and the Debtor or Creditor Trust, as applicable, on the later of the Effective Date and the date such Other Secured Claim becomes Allowed, or as soon thereafter as is practicable, the Creditor Trust shall, at the Creditor Trust's sole and exclusive election and to the extent applicable, in full and final satisfaction of such Other Secured Claim, do one of the following:
(i) Deliver to the holder of such Claim the collateral securing such Allowed Other Secured Claim;
(ii) Pay to the holder of such Claim Cash in an amount equal to the value of such collateral; or
(iii) Provide such other treatment that renders such Allowed Other Secured Claim Unimpaired.
(c) *Voting*: Class 1 is Unimpaired, and each holder of an Other Secured Claim is conclusively deemed to have accepted the Plan and, therefore, is not entitled to vote on the Plan.
- 2. Priority Non-Tax Claims (Class 2) - (a) *Classification*: Class 2 consists of Priority Non-Tax Claims.
(b) *Treatment:* Unless otherwise mutually agreed upon by the holder of an Allowed Class 2 Priority Non-Tax Claim and the Debtor or Creditor Trust, as applicable, on the later of the Effective Date and the date such Allowed Priority Non-Tax Claim becomes Allowed, or as soon thereafter as is practicable, the Creditor Trust shall pay to each holder of an Allowed Class 2 Priority Non-Tax Claim the full amount of such Allowed Class 2 Priority Non-Tax Claim in Cash in full and final satisfaction of such Allowed Priority Non-Tax Claim.
(c) *Voting*: Class 2 is Unimpaired, and each holder of a Class 2 Priority Non-Tax Claim is conclusively deemed to have accepted the Plan and, therefore, is not entitled to vote on the Plan.
- 3. Unsecured Litigation Claims (Class 3) - (a) *Classification*: Class 3 consists of Unsecured Litigation Claims.
(b) *Treatment*: Holders of Allowed Unsecured Litigation Claims may elect between the following mutually exclusive treatment options:
(i) On or as soon as practicable after the Initial Distribution Date and/or any Subsequent Distribution Date, the Creditor Trust shall pay to the Holder, in full and final satisfaction of such Allowed Unsecured Litigation Claim, an amount of Cash equal to ten percent (10%) of the allowed amount of such claim;
#### Case 22-50073 Doc 197 Filed 04/10/22 Entered 04/10/22 21:11:27 Page 18 of 41 Case 22-50073 Doc 249-7 Filed 04/22/22 Entered 04/22/22 16:44:32 Page 18 of 41
(ii) On or as soon as practicable after the Initial Distribution Date and/or any Subsequent Distribution Date, the Creditor Trust shall pay to the Holder, in full and final satisfaction of such Allowed Unsecured Litigation Claim, its Pro Rata share of the Remaining Creditor Trust Estate Assets; *provided that* prior to the voting record date on the Plan, such Holder shall indicate its preference to make, or not make, the Boat Election.
(c) *Voting*: Class 3 is Impaired, and holders of Unsecured Litigation Claims are entitled to vote to accept or reject the Plan.
4. Unsecured Trade Claims (Class 4)
(a) *Classification*: Class 4 consists of Unsecured Trade Claims.
(b) *Treatment*: On or as soon as practicable after the Initial Distribution Date and/or any Subsequent Distribution Date, the Creditor Trust shall pay each Holder of an Allowed Unsecured Trade Claim, in full and final satisfaction of such Allowed Unsecured Trade Claim, an amount of Cash equal to ten percent (10%) of the allowed amount of such Claim.
(c) *Voting*: Class 4 is Impaired, and holders of Unsecured Trade Claims are entitled to vote to accept or reject the Plan.
- 5. Litigation Funding Claims (Class 5) - (a) *Classification*: Class 5 consists of the Litigation Funding Claims.
(b) *Treatment*: The Holders of the Class 5 Litigation Funding Claims shall receive the Subordinated Liquidating Trust Interests in satisfaction of such Class 5 Family Office Claims; *provided, however*, no distribution shall be made on account of a Class 5 Litigation Funding Claim in excess of the Allowed Amount of such Claim.
(c) *Voting*: Class 5 is Impaired, and the holders of the Litigation Funding Claims are entitled to vote to accept or reject the Plan. To the extent the Holder of a Litigation Funding Claim is an Insider of the Debtor, the vote by such Holder shall not be considered for purposes of satisfaction of section 1129(a)(10) of the Bankruptcy Code.

#### 2. Creation and Governance of the Creditor Trust.
(a) On the Effective Date, the Creditor Trustee shall execute the Creditor Trust Agreement and shall take any other steps necessary to establish the Creditor Trust in accordance with the Plan and the beneficial interests therein. The Creditor Trust Agreement shall contain provisions customary to trust agreements utilized in comparable circumstances, including, without limitation, any and all provisions necessary to ensure the continued treatment of the Creditor Trust as a grantor trust and the Creditor Trust Beneficiaries as the grantors and owners thereof for federal income tax purposes. The Creditor Trust Agreement may provide powers, duties, and authorities in addition to those explicitly stated herein, but only to the extent that such powers, duties, and authorities do not affect the status of the Creditor Trust as a "liquidating trust" for United States federal income tax purposes.
(b) Upon establishment of the Creditor Trust, all Creditor Trust Estate Assets shall be deemed transferred to the Creditor Trust on the Effective Date without any further action of any of the Debtor or any employees, agents, advisors, or representatives of the Debtor. The Creditor Trustee shall agree to accept and hold the CT Assets for the benefit of the Creditor Trust Beneficiaries, subject to the terms of the Plan and the Creditor Trust Agreement. The Debtor, the Plan Funders, the Creditor Trustee, the Creditor Trust Beneficiaries, and any party under the control of such parties will execute any documents or other instruments and shall take all other steps as necessary to cause title to the Creditor Trust Estate Assets, the Boat and the UC Cash to be transferred to the Creditor Trust.
(c) For federal income tax purposes, the transfer of the assets to the Creditor Trust will be treated as a taxable sale or other disposition of assets to the Creditor Trust Beneficiaries in exchange for their Claims in the Chapter 11 Case. A Holder of a Claim should in most circumstances recognize gain or loss equal to the difference between the "amount realized" received by such Holder in exchange for its Claim and such Holder's adjusted tax basis in the claim. The "amount realized" is equal to the sum of the cash and the fair market value of any other consideration received in such exchange. The tax basis of a Holder in a Claim will generally be equal to the holder's cost therefor. To the extent applicable, the character of any recognized gain or loss (that is, ordinary income, or short-term or long-term capital gain or loss) will depend upon the status of the Holder, the nature of the claim in the Holder's hands, the purposes and circumstances of the claim's acquisition, the Holder's holding period of the claim, and the extent to which the holder previously claimed a deduction for the worthlessness of all or a portion of the claim.
(d) For United States federal income tax purposes, all parties (including, without limitation, the Debtor, the Creditor Trustee, and the Creditor Trust Beneficiaries) shall treat the transfer of the Creditor Trust Estate Assets, Boat and UC Cash to the Creditor Trust as (1) a transfer of the Creditor Trust Estate Assets to the Creditor Trust Beneficiaries, followed by (2) the contribution of such assets to the Creditor Trust in exchange for interests therein. As soon as possible after the Effective Date, the Creditor Trustee shall make (or cause to be made) a good faith valuation of the assets of the Creditor Trust, and such valuation shall be used consistently by all parties for United States federal income tax purposes. Accordingly, Creditor Trust Beneficiaries shall be treated for United States federal income tax purposes as the grantors and owners of their respective shares of CT Assets (other than such Creditor Trust Estate Assets as are allocable to Disputed Claims). The foregoing treatment shall also apply, to the extent permitted by applicable law, for state and local income tax purposes.
(e) The Creditor Trustee shall file returns for the Creditor Trust as a grantor trust pursuant to Treasury Regulations section 1.671-4(a) and in accordance with the Plan. The Creditor Trust's taxable income, gain, loss, deduction, or credit will be allocated to each of the Creditor Trust Beneficiaries in accordance with their relative beneficial interests in the Creditor Trust.
(f) Allocations of Creditor Trust taxable income among Creditor Trust Beneficiaries (other than taxable income allocable to any assets allocable to, or retained on account of, Disputed Claims) shall be determined by reference to the manner in which an amount of Cash representing such taxable income would be distributed (were such Cash permitted to be distributed at such time) if, immediately prior to such deemed Distribution, the Creditor Trust had distributed all its assets (valued at their tax book value, other than assets allocable Disputed Claims) to the holders of Creditor Trust Interests, adjusted for prior taxable income and loss and taking into account all prior and concurrent Distributions from the Creditor Trust. Similarly, taxable loss of the Creditor Trust shall be allocated by reference to the manner in which an economic loss would be borne immediately after a hypothetical liquidating distribution of the remaining Creditor Trust Estate Assets. The tax book value of CT Assets for purpose of this paragraph shall equal their fair market value on the date CT Assets are transferred to the Creditor Trust, adjusted in accordance with tax accounting principles prescribed by the IRC, the applicable Treasury Regulations, and other applicable administrative and judicial authorities and pronouncements.
(g) Subject to definitive guidance from the IRS or a court of competent jurisdiction to the contrary, the Creditor Trustee (i) may timely elect to treat any CT Assets allocable to Disputed Claims as a "disputed ownership fund" governed by Treas. Reg. § 1.468B-9, and (ii) to the extent permitted by applicable law, shall report consistently for state and local income tax purposes. If a "disputed ownership fund" election is made, all parties (including the Creditor Trustee and Creditor Trust Beneficiaries) shall report for United States federal, state and local income tax purposes consistently with the foregoing.
(h) The Creditor Trust shall be responsible for payment, out of Creditor Trust Estate Assets, of any taxes imposed on the Creditor Trust (including any Disputed Claim Reserve) or the Creditor Trust Estate Assets. More particularly, any taxes imposed on any Disputed Claim Reserve or its assets will be paid out of the assets of the Disputed Claim Reserve (including any Creditor Trust Estate Assets allocable to Disputed Claims), and netted against any subsequent distributions in respect of the allowance or disallowance of such Claims.
(i) The Creditor Trust shall be governed by the Creditor Trust Agreement and administered by the Creditor Trustee. The powers, rights, and responsibilities of the Creditor Trustee shall be specified in the Creditor Trust Agreement.

10. Dissolution of the Creditor Trust. The Creditor Trustee and the Creditor Trust shall be discharged or dissolved, as the case may be, at such time as (i) all assets of the Creditor Trust have been liquidated and (ii) all distributions required to be made by the Creditor Trustee under the Plan have been made, but in no event shall the Creditor Trust be dissolved later than five (5) years from the Effective Date unless the Bankruptcy Court, upon motion within the six (6) month period prior to the fifth (5th) anniversary (and, in the case of any extension, within six (6) months prior to the end of such extension), determines that a fixed period extension (not to exceed three (3) years, together with any prior extensions, without a favorable letter ruling from the IRS that any further extension would not adversely affect the status of the Creditor Trust as a liquidating trust for federal income tax purposes) is necessary to facilitate or complete the recovery and liquidation of the assets of the Creditor Trust.

#### <span id="page-27-1"></span>E. *Delivery of Distributions*
1. General Provisions; Undeliverable Distributions
Subject to Bankruptcy Rule 9010 and except as otherwise provided herein, Distributions to the Holders of Allowed Claims shall be made by the Creditor Trustee or his or her designee, assuming the availability of funds and the economic feasibility of such Distributions, at (a) the address of each Holder as set forth in the Schedules, unless superseded by the address set forth on proofs of Claim Filed by such Holder or (b) the last known address of such Holder if no proof of Claim is Filed or if the Debtor or Creditor Trustee have been notified in writing of a change of address. The Creditor Trustee shall make distributions under the Plan on behalf of the Reorganized Debtor. If any Distribution is returned as undeliverable, the Creditor Trustee may, in his or her discretion, make reasonable efforts to determine the current address of the holder of the Claim with respect to which the Distribution was made as the Creditor Trustee deems appropriate, provided that (i) no Distribution to any such Holder shall be made unless and until the Creditor Trustee has determined the then-current address of such Holder, at which time the Distribution to such Holder shall be made to the holder without interest, and (ii) if the Creditor Trustee is unable to determine the then-current address of such Holder, such Distribution shall be deemed unclaimed as of the first date of return as undeliverable and treated as set forth below in Article V.E.3. The Creditor Trustee shall have the discretion to determine how to make Distributions in the most efficient and cost-effective manner possible; *provided*, *however*, that his or her discretion may not be exercised in a manner inconsistent with any express requirements of the Plan.
#### 2. Minimum Distributions
If any interim Distribution under the Plan would be less than \$500.00, the Reorganized Debtor or Creditor Trustee, as applicable, may withhold such Distribution until a final Distribution is made to such Holder. If any final Distribution under the Plan would be \$100.00 or less, no such Distribution will be made to that Holder unless a request therefor is made in writing to the Creditor Trust.
#### 3. Unclaimed Property
Except with respect to property not Distributed because it is being held in reserve for Disputed Claims, Distributions that are not claimed by the expiration of ninety (90) days from the date of the relevant Distribution shall be deemed to be unclaimed property under Section 347(b) of the Bankruptcy Code and shall vest or revest in the Creditor Trust. The Claims with respect to which those Distributions are made shall be automatically cancelled. After the expiration of that three-month period, the claim of any Entity to those Distributions shall be discharged and forever barred. Nothing contained in the Plan shall require the Creditor Trust to attempt to locate any Holder of an Allowed Claim. All funds or other property that vest or revest in the Creditor Trust pursuant to this paragraph shall be (a) used to pay the fees and expenses of the Creditor Trust as and to the extent set forth in the Plan, and (b) thereafter distributed to Holders of Allowed Claims as otherwise provided herein. In the event any Creditor Trust Estate Assets remain after all economically feasible Distributions are made, such remaining property may be abandoned; liquidated to Cash and distributed to a registered 501(c)(3) organization of the Creditor Trust's choice, assuming such distribution is economically feasible, or otherwise disposed. Neither unclaimed property nor any remaining portion of the Creditor Trust Estate Assets shall escheat to any federal, state or local government or other entity.

### **ARTICLE VII**
### **TREATMENT OF EXECUTORY CONTRACTS AND UNEXPIRED LEASES**
#### <span id="page-30-3"></span><span id="page-30-2"></span>A. *Rejection of Executory Contracts and Unexpired Leases*
1. On the Effective Date, except as otherwise provided herein, each executory contract or unexpired lease not previously rejected, assumed, or assumed and assigned, shall be deemed automatically rejected pursuant to sections 365 and 1123 of the Bankruptcy Code, unless such executory contract or unexpired lease: (a) is specifically described in the Plan or Plan Supplement as to be assumed in connection with Confirmation of the Plan; (b) is subject as of the Confirmation Date to a pending motion to assume or assume and assign; (c) has been assumed or assumed and assigned to a third party; (d) is a contract, instrument, release, indenture, or other agreement or document entered into in connection with the Plan. Entry of the Confirmation Order by the Bankruptcy Court shall constitute approval of such assumptions, assignments, and rejections pursuant to sections 365(a) and 1123 of the Bankruptcy Code.
2. Notwithstanding anything contained in the Plan to the contrary, in the event of a dispute as to whether a contract is executory or a lease is unexpired, the rights of the Debtor or the Reorganized Debtor, as applicable, to move to assume or reject such contract or lease shall be extended until the date that is thirty (30) days after entry of a Final Order by the Bankruptcy Court determining that the contract is executory or the lease is unexpired.
3. Any monetary defaults under each Executory Contract and Unexpired Lease to be assumed or assumed and assigned pursuant to the Plan shall be satisfied, pursuant to section 365(b)(1) of the Bankruptcy Code, by payment of the Cure Cost in Cash on the Effective Date, subject to the limitation described in the following paragraph, or on such other terms as the parties to such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ease may otherwise agree. Together with the Plan Supplement, to the extent not previously filed with the Court and served on affected counterparties, the Debtor shall provide for notices of proposed assumption and proposed Cure Cost (and, to the extent the Debtor seek to assume and assign an Unexpired Lease pursuant to the Plan, the Debtor will identify the assignee, if any, and provide adequate assurance of future performance by such assignee within the meaning of section 365 of the Bankruptcy Code) to be filed and served upon applicable contract and lease counterparties (and upon such Entities' counsel, if known), together with procedures for objecting thereto and resolution of disputes by the Court. Any objection by a contract or
#### Case 22-50073 Doc 197 Filed 04/10/22 Entered 04/10/22 21:11:27 Page 32 of 41 Case 22-50073 Doc 249-7 Filed 04/22/22 Entered 04/22/22 16:44:32 Page 32 of 41
lease counterparty to a proposed Cure Cost must be filed, served, and actually received by the Debtor before the objection deadline provided in the notice of proposed assumption and Cure Cost, which deadline shall be no less than fourteen (14) days after the date on which the applicable notice of proposed assumption and proposed Cure Cost is filed and served. Any objection by a contract or lease counterparty to a proposed assumption, assumption and assignment, or adequate assurance (other than with respect to a proposed Cure Cost) must be filed, served, and actually received by the Debtor before the Plan Objection Deadline. Any counterparty to an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ease that fails to object timely to the proposed assumption or Cure Cost will be deemed to have assented to such assumption or Cure Cost. Any objection to a proposed assumption, assumption and assignment, or Cure Cost will be scheduled to be heard by the Court at the Reorganized Debtor's first scheduled omnibus hearing after which such objection is timely filed. In the event of a dispute regarding (1) the amount of any Cure Cost, (2) the ability of the Reorganized Debtor or any assignee to provide "adequate assurance of future performance" within the meaning of section 365(b) of the Bankruptcy Code, if applicable, under the Executory Contract or the Unexpired Lease to be assumed or assumed and assigned, and/or (3) any other matter pertaining to assumption and/or assignment, then such Cure Costs shall be paid following the entry of a Final Order resolving the dispute and approving the assumption and assignment of such Executory Contracts or Unexpired Leases or as may be agreed upon by the Debtor or the Reorganized Debtor and the counterparty to such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ease; provided that the Debtor may settle any dispute regarding the amount of any Cure Cost without any further notice to any party or any action, order, or approval of the Court; provided, further, that notwithstanding anything to the contrary herein, the Debtor reserve the right to reject, or nullify the assumption of, any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ease within twentyfive (25) days after the entry of a Final Order resolving an objection to assumption or assumption and assignment, determining the Cure Cost under an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ease that was subject to a dispute, or resolving any request for adequate assurance of future performance required to assume such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ease in an amount higher than sought by the Debtor.
4. Subject to the terms of the preceding paragraphs, assumption or assumption and assignment of any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ease pursuant to the Plan or otherwise, and the payment of the Cure Cost, shall result in the full release and satisfaction of any Claims or defaults, whether monetary or nonmonetary, including defaults of provisions restricting the change in control or ownership interest composition or other bankruptcy-related defaults, arising under any assumed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ease at any time prior to the effective date of assumption or assumption and assignment. Any Proofs of Claim filed with respect to an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ease that has been assumed or assumed and assigned, and the Cure Cost paid, shall be deemed disallowed and expunged, without further notice to or action, order, or approval of the Court.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the Debtor and the Reorganized Debtor will continue to honor all postpetition and post-Effective Date obligations under any assumed Executory Contracts and Unexpired Leases in accordance with their terms, regardless of whether such obligations are listed as a Cure Cost, and whether such obligations accrued prior to or after the Effective Date, and neither the payment of cure nor entry of the Confirmation Order shall be deemed to release the Debtor or the Reorganized Debtor from such obligations. Notwithstanding the foregoing, assumption of any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ease and/or payment of any Cure Cost shall not constitute a release of any Claims held by the Debtor or Reorganized Debtor against any party, other than for breach or default of such assumed Executory Contract or Unexpired Lease.
